口說無憑,直接上代碼
@Configuration
publicclassCorsConfig {
????privateCorsConfiguration buildConfig() {
????????CorsConfiguration corsConfiguration = newCorsConfiguration();
????????corsConfiguration.addAllowedOrigin("*");
????????corsConfiguration.addAllowedHeader("*");
????????corsConfiguration.addAllowedMethod("*");
????????returncorsConfiguration;
????}
????@Bean
????publicCorsFilter corsFilter() {
????????UrlBasedCorsConfigurationSource source = newUrlBasedCorsConfigurationSource();
????????source.registerCorsConfiguration("/**", buildConfig());
????????returnnewCorsFilter(source);
????}
}
1-新建配置文件,添加Configuration注解
2-測(cè)試跨域請(qǐng)求通過,至此已完美解決ajax跨域問題,是不是很easy,小伙伴兒們快去試試把!!!